From WordNet (r) 2.0 [wn]:

  anthrax
       n 1: a highly infectious animal disease (especially cattle and
            sheep); it can be transmitted to people [syn: {splenic
            fever}]
       2: a disease of humans that is not communicable; caused by
          infection with Bacillus anthracis followed by septicemia


       3: a species of Bacillus that causes anthrax in humans and in
          animals (cattle and swine and sheep and sheep and rabbits
          and mice and guinea pigs); can be used a bioweapon [syn: {Bacillus
          anthracis}]
       [also: {anthraces} (pl)]
